Swoon

Lead Python Platform Engineer

Toronto, ON, CA

$120k/year
6 days ago
Save Job

Summary

🔧 Lead Python Platform Engineer – Notebooks Platform | Hybrid (Toronto)

📍 2 Days Onsite | Downtown Toronto

đź’Ľ Type: Full-Time


Our client, a leading financial institution, is undertaking a major platform evolution as part of a strategic global expansion. With the acquisition of new international markets, the data and engineering teams are scaling fast — and they need a Lead Python Engineer to take charge of their core Notebooks platform.


This is not your typical Python dev role. You’ll lead engineering efforts on a powerful, open-source-based platform (Jupyter), deeply embedded in business workflows and data pipelines across the org. Think: platform ownership, product thinking, and building tools that hundreds of data practitioners rely on every day.


🚀 What You’ll Own

  • Platform Leadership – Maintain and improve a customized Jupyter-based platform, ensuring performance, scalability, and reliability.
  • Feature Design & Development – Build out core libraries, tools, and user-facing features in Python.
  • Power User Support – Guide users on platform best practices, review designs, and deliver quick-turn POCs.
  • Infra Oversight – Collaborate on deployments using Docker/Kubernetes (small portion of role).
  • Stakeholder Collaboration – Serve as the point of contact between business, engineering, and user teams.


đź§  What You Bring

  • Senior-level experience with Python, especially in platform/tooling or infrastructure contexts.
  • Hands-on knowledge of Jupyter, Databricks, Anaconda, or similar notebook platforms.
  • Exposure to cloud-native tooling (Docker, Kubernetes) — even if it's not your main focus.
  • Experience mentoring junior developers and collaborating across business/tech teams.
  • A product-owner mindset — you're just as excited about how users experience a platform as you are about building it.


💡 Why You’ll Love This Role

  • Your work powers real-world decision-making across the org — not just code in a silo.
  • You’ll lead the overhaul of a mission-critical, high-visibility platform.
  • The team is full of engineers, scientists, and creative minds who love solving complex problems.


This is a hybrid role, with 2 days per week onsite in downtown Toronto. If you're passionate about Python, platform architecture, and working at the intersection of data and product — we’d love to connect.


The target hiring compensation range for this role is 120k/year-140k/year. Compensation is based on several factors including, but not limited to education, relevant work experience, relevant certifications, and location.

How strong is your resume?

Upload your resume and get feedback from our expert to help land this job